Recall notice

Mindblow Energy drinks - recalled due to non-permitted ingredients that may pose a serious health risk

2 years ago source recalls-rappels.canada.ca

Canada

The affected products are being recalled from the marketplace due to non-permitted ingredients, including Munuca Pruriens Extract (98% L-Dopa) that may pose a serious health risk. This product is distributed Online and in Quebec and Possibly other provinces and territories. There have been no reported reactions associated with the consumption of these products.

-Affected products:
Brand: Mindblow, Product: Energy Drink - Original Edition, Size: 473 mL, UPC: 8 60006 52613 9, Codes: All codes
Brand: Mindblow, Product: Energy Drink - Pink Lemonade, Size: 473 mL, UPC: 8 60006 52611 5, Codes: All codes

If you think you became sick from consuming a recalled product, contact your healthcare provider; Check to see if you have recalled products; and do not consume, serve, use, sell, or distribute recalled products.

Recalled products should be returned to the location where they were purchased.

If you buy food products online, follow our tips and do not assume that the products meet Canadian requirements.

L-Dopa, also known as levodopa, is a prescription drug that is combined with other drug ingredients in anti-Parkinson's medications. It should be used only under the supervision of a healthcare professional. Levodopa may interact with drugs prescribed for high blood pressure, and should not be used by women who are pregnant, who plan to become pregnant or who are breastfeeding. It should also not be taken by people with narrow-angle glaucoma; untreated heart, liver, kidney, lung or hormonal diseases; a history of melanoma; or those who should not take drugs such as isoproterenol, amphetamines or epinephrine. Side effects requiring medical attention include uncontrollable movements of the face, eyelids, mouth, tongue, neck, arms, hands, or legs; severe or persistent nausea or vomiting; an irregular heartbeat or fluttering in the chest; feeling lightheaded when standing quickly; or unusual changes in mood or behavior.

Company name: Les distributions Mindblow inc
Brand name: Mindblow
Product recalled: Energy Drinks
Reason of the recall: Issue Food - Chemical
CFIA Recall date: 2023-08-17
